The sustainable development of ger areasin Ulaanbaatar (UB), the capital city of Mongolia, is one ofthe critical development issues facing the country. Thetransitions to a market economy and a series of severewinters (called zud) have resulted in the large-scalemigration of low-income families into the ger areas of UB.The city represents 40 percent of the nation'spopulation and generates more than 60 percent ofMongolia's gross domestic product (GDP).
